About US
International Lifeline Fund Lifeline is a non-profit organization that began
working in refugee and displacement camps, emergency settings, and emerging
markets in 2003 to enable sustainable access to fuel-efficient cooking
technologies and reliable safe water. Lifeline operates under the conviction
that many of the core problems underpinning global poverty – such as lack of
access to efficient cooking technologies and clean water – can be addressed
through market forces that sustain community-driven economic growth and
livelihood benefits. With all our initiatives, Lifeline’s approach engages
community stakeholders in the design, ownership, and long-term profit of these
natural resource enterprises.
Job Summary ⇒ Under the overall guidance of the Senior Program Manager-WASH
and Senior Program Manager-Environment, the Senior M&E Officer will be
responsible for leading the monitoring and evaluation of high quality WASH and
humanitarian energy projects, and support the data management of the EverFlow
Africa water point maintenance and repair social enterprise, as needed. The
Senior M&E Officer will keep the team up to date in terms of data capturing
tools, data security, and the EverFlow business system. This position will
work in close collaboration with the WASH department, Environment department,
EverFlow team, and program management at both the Uganda country and global
office levels.
Key Duties and Responsibilities
⇗ Assist in development of project log frame matrices, particularly in the
areas of performance indicators and their measurements.
⇗ Lead the WASH and Environment teams’ utility and maintenance of the mWater
database and Solstice database, if needed to accurately capture and analyze
project and program data. Periodically review and revise the systems so that
they are adapted appropriately to the requirements of the projects and
programs.
⇗ Lead a team of enumerators to collect data on a regular basis to measure
achievements against performance indicators.
⇗ Ensure relevant and timely M&E data is provided in user-friendly formats to
key stakeholders.
⇗ Analyze M&E data for both learning and reporting purposes and provide
Lifeline staff and its partners with evidence-based feedback strengths and
gaps on a regular basis. Produce monthly and quarterly reports and prepare
presentations based on M&E data, as required.
⇗ Suggest improvements to the current M&E frameworks, as needed, to align
program goals with performance indicators. For example, upgrading needs
assessment surveys, baseline surveys, project progress reports, impact
assessments, and final evaluations.
⇗ Identify lessons learned and develop case studies to capture qualitative
and quantitative outputs of the project and improve project performance using
M&E findings.
⇗ Assist Program managers to prepare project workplans & consolidate
organizational wide annual workplans.
⇗ Provide Lifeline team in-house trainings on adopted M&E methodologies and
relevant techniques.
⇗ Work closely with the WASH, Environment, and EverFlow teams to achieve any
other program objectives, as needed.
Qualifications, Skills and Experience
⇗ The ideal candidate must hold a Bachelor’s degree in statistics, economics,
or related field or equivalent work experience
⇗ At least three years of professional working experience with a reputable
organization, and a post-graduate degree in M&E from a recognized university,
is preferred.
⇗ Strong quantitative and qualitative skills, able to present analysis in
written and graphic format
⇗ Demonstrable experience in project planning and performance measurement
including KPI selection, target setting, and developing an M&E plan.
⇗ Knowledge of various evaluation, data collection and analysis
methodologies, and how to strategically apply these methodologies given their
relative strengths and drawbacks.
⇗ Strong working knowledge of the mWater and/or Solstice platforms and at
least one statistical software program e.g., SPSS, STATA, SAS is preferred.
⇗ Operate as an ethical, responsible, hard-working, and self-driven
professional in a team setting.
